Sourdough for a Nutritional Powerhouse
Sourdough bread, in contrast, is often celebrated for its nutritional Positive aspects. Manufactured by way of a normal fermentation system, sourdough has a reduce glycemic index in comparison to other breads, that means it's a slower effect on blood sugar amounts. This causes it to be a greater option for sustaining Vitality levels all over the faculty working day.

Also, the fermentation system in sourdough breaks down a lot of the gluten and phytic acid from the flour, which makes it easier to digest and boosting the bioavailability of nutrients like magnesium, iron, and zinc. This positions sourdough as being a nutritious selection for university meals, particularly when designed with whole grains.

The Accessibility of Sourdough: Price tag and Planning Worries
Even though sourdough gives numerous wellbeing Positive aspects, its integration into school foodstuff programs is not really without having challenges. One particular significant barrier is Value. Sourdough bread, particularly when designed with high-excellent, natural and organic ingredients, might be dearer than commercially created bread. This causes it to be challenging for educational facilities, Particularly All those with limited budgets, to offer sourdough routinely.

A further obstacle is preparing. Sourdough requires a for a longer time fermentation approach, that may be challenging to manage in a faculty kitchen. Some educational facilities have resolved this by partnering with neighborhood bakeries, but this Alternative might not be feasible in all spots.
